About Hamrahi (1963) — A Classic Bollywood Romance-Drama That Will Capture Your Heart

Hamrahi (1963) is a classic Bollywood romance-drama that explores themes of love, family, and redemption. Directed by Tatineni Prakash Rao, the film tells the story of Shekhar, a charming but womanizing young man who marries Saradha against her will. As Shekhar navigates his complicated relationships with his wife and parents, he must confront the consequences of his actions and learn to earn Saradha's love and respect.
